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

IP_EX_TUNETIME

XRE Tunes New

Fields

XRE raw

Raw event fields

Definition

Unit

STB Field

abrSwitchN/AN/AN/A - Present in IP_EX_TUNETIME, but not meaningful (always zero)XRE Tunes New
assetdurationFor VOD / cDVR : Total duration of the asset.
For Linear : Total duration of the initial playlist.
SecondsYes
XRE Tunes NewbackToXreDurationTime taken for the tune complete notificaton to reach Receiver from Player.SecondsYes
XRE Tunes NewbeginLoadDurationTime taken for the tune request to reach Player from Receiver.SecondsYesXRE Tunes New
contenttypeContent type of the playback: cdvr, vod, ip-linear, ivod, ip-eas, camera, dvr, mdvr, ipdvr, ppv.StringYesXRE Tunes NewdrmReadyDurationTotal duration of DRM part to be ready for the playback, which includes the challenge generation, license acquisition duration & response processing durations.SecondsYesXRE Tunes New
errorCode-Not reported in IP_EX_TUNETIMEXRE Tunes NewfirstFragment-Not reported in IP_EX_TUNETIME
XRE Tunes NewfirstLicenseLicence acquisition  time.SecondsYes
XRE Tunes NewfirstManifest*main manifest download time (DASH or HLS)N/AN/A - Present in IP_EX_TUNETIME, but not meaningful (always zero)
XRE Tunes NewfirstProfile*first playlist/profile manifest download time (HLS-specific)N/AN/A - Present in IP_EX_TUNETIME, but not meaningful (always zero)
XRE Tunes NewFragmentCount
-Not reported in IP_EX_TUNETIMEXRE Tunes New
fragmentTotalTotal time to download both video and audio fragment(s).SecondsYesXRE Tunes New
isDDPlus*true if presenting content with DD+ audioN/AN/A - Present in IP_EX_TUNETIME, but not meaningful (always zero)XRE Tunes New
isDemuxed*true if presenting demuxed content (always true for DASH, configurable for HLS)N/AN/A - Present in IP_EX_TUNETIME, but not meaningful (always zero)XRE Tunes NewisBackupMedium-Not reported in IP_EX_TUNETIME
XRE Tunes NewisFogtrue iff FOG/time-shift buffer is in use for current playbackTrue/FalseYes
XRE Tunes NewisPostTuneIndicates the completion of tune transaction. Mostly, used for error cases to indicate subsequent errors (in such cases isPostTune=true). All MEDIATUNE_500 logs with status=SUCCESS will have isPostTune=false (?)True/FalseNot reported in IP_EX_TUNETIME
XRE Tunes NewisRetryTunetrue in cases when linearRetryCounter > 0 or vodRetryCounter > 0.-Not reported in IP_EX_TUNETIME
(or) when auto heal attempt started after playback failure.-Not reported in IP_EX_TUNETIMEXRE Tunes NewmanifestCount-Not reported in IP_EX_TUNETIMEXRE Tunes New
manifestTotalTotal time duration of main manifest download (possibly including retries)SecondsYesXRE Tunes New
mediaTypeType of media item which is determined by locator (like OCAP/DVR/CDVR/MDVR/LOCAL_IP_DVR/DLNA etc).StringNot reported in IP_EX_TUNETIME
XRE Tunes NewneededLicensetrue if the first fragment decoded was encrypted, and involved license acquisition.  Note that encrypted streams may include a clear pre-roll yielding false for this valueTrue/FalseYes
XRE Tunes New
networkTimeTotal duration for network activities (includes manifest, fragment & license downloads) - note that these delays may occur in parallelSecondsYesXRE Tunes NewOriginalUUIDAdded to indicate UUID of the first/initial tune which failed and led to retry.-Not reported in IP_EX_TUNETIME
XRE Tunes NewplayerRequestLatencyTime spent between attempt to play in guide app and attempt to play in player app. Indicates stability in RPC communication between guide and player apps.-Not reported in IP_EX_TUNETIME
XRE Tunes NewplayerResponseLatencyTime spent between attempt to play and tune response (success or failure) in player app.-Not reported in IP_EX_TUNETIME
XRE Tunes NewprepareToPlayDurationTotal duration from tune start until to Manifest download.SecondsYes
XRE Tunes NewpreviousdeliverymediumN/A-Not reported in IP_EX_TUNETIME
XRE Tunes NewpreviousPlayBackModeN/A-Not reported in IP_EX_TUNETIME
XRE Tunes NewprofilesTotaltotal download times for audio and video playlist (HLS-specific) - note that these may be downloaded in parallelSecondsYesXRE Tunes NewrecieverPlatform-Not reported in IP_EX_TUNETIMEXRE Tunes New
responseStatusDescription of media tune event from player. Usually, it is not empty in failure cases. "Retrying" in case when isRetryTune=true.-Not reported in IP_EX_TUNETIME
XRE Tunes NewstartPlayDurationTotal duration from tune start until to playlist download.
(* which is calculated max duration of either manifest or video playlist or audio playlist, and this field is specific to HLS)
SecondsYes
XRE Tunes NewstartStreamingDurationTotal duration from tune start until to get first frame decoded nofitication.SecondsYes
XRE Tunes New
status
-Not reported in IP_EX_TUNETIME
XRE Tunes NewtotalTimeEstimated actual tune time of video engine excluding backToXreDuration.SecondsYesXRE Tunes New
tuneSuccesstrue if this was a successful tuneTrue/FalseYes
XRE Tunes NewtrmLatencyTime which was spent to acquire the reservation using TRM (RMF/QAM-specific)-Not reported in IP_EX_TUNETIME
XRE Tunes NewbackToXreStartStart time of the tune complete event notification from Player to Receiver.EpochYes
XRE Tunes NewbeginLoadStartCalender time of tune request to reach Player from Receiver.EpochYes
XRE Tunes NewdrmReadyStartStart time of DRM license acquisition.EpochYes
XRE Tunes NewfailRetryDurationTotal duration of failed tune attempts.SecondsYesXRE Tunes NewplaybackIndexIncrements for each new tune since boot, allowing the event to distinguish between initial and subsequent tunes.NumberYes
XRE Tunes NewplayerEnginePlayer type - for IP will be "AAMP"StringYes
XRE Tunes NewprepareToPlayStartCalender time of manifest download time.EpochYes
XRE Tunes NewprofileCountNumber of profiles available for ABR.-Not reported in IP_EX_TUNETIME
XRE Tunes NewstartPlayCalender time of playlist download time.EpochYes
XRE Tunes NewstartStreamingStartCalender time of First frame display time.EpochYes
XRE Tunes NewtuneAttemptsTotal number of tune attempts for a playback including JavaScript managed retriesNumberYes